SIM! Uma Demo para testar todas as novas tecnologias apresentadas no PDC 09.
Olá pessoal. No Keynote do Bob Muglia no PDC 09 foi apresentado uma Demo (cruz credo! rs) que cobre as tecnologias ASP.NET MVC 2 beta, Windows Identity Foundation RTM, e o beta do Windows Server AppFabric.
Esta Demo é o Tailspin Travel application, que já está disponível no codeplex neste endereço: https://tailspintravel.codeplex.com/ .
A aplicação é um marcador de viagens. A idéia é bem simples, mas a aplicação é muito bem feita. Ele cobre praticamente todas as novas funcionalidades das tecnologias e permite que você mude o comportamento da aplicação em Runtime para poder testa-las.
Essa é a relação de funcionalidades cobertas pela Demo:
Visual Studio 2010
- Assembly Dependency Graph
- Multi-monitor
- Navigate To dialogue
- IntelliTrace
- New WF designer
- MSDeploy
- Coded-UI tests
.NET Framework 4
- ASP.NET MVC 2
- Windows Identity Foundation
- Windows Workflow Foundation
- Windows Communication Foundation
- Entity Framework
Server Platform
- Windows Server AppFabric
- Service Hosting
- Workflow Hosting
- Caching
- Monitoring
- SQL Server 2008 R2
- DAC - Data-Tier Application
Você precisa do Visual Studio 2010 Beta 2 Ultimate para abrir e compilar o código. O SQL Server 2008 R2 só é obrigatório para o deploy do Data-Tier Application. Baixei e rodei nas minhas VMs com SQL 2008 sem problema.
Ufá, muita coisa pra estudar e, instalar tudo isso leva um bom tempo. Vou tentar fazer ainda esta semana um post explicando com o instalar e configurar o AppFabric + Tailspin Demo.
Para preparar o ambiente, além do Visual Studio 2010 Beta 2 Ultimate você precisará dos seguintes produtos:
- ASP.NET MVC 2 Beta
- Windows Identity Foundation RTM
- Windows Server AppFabric Beta
- Tailspin Travel application
Por enquanto é só.
Atualizado em 25 de novembro de 2009:
Algumas pessoas me falaram que durante a verificação de dependência apareceu o erro: "AuthorizationManager check failed.". A solução é bem simples e está descrita aqui: https://tailspintravel.codeplex.com/Thread/View.aspx?ThreadId=76189
Abraços,
Daibert